Dillon Ruml (born 4 March 1999) is a speedway rider from the United States.[1][2]

Speedway career edit

Ruml was the AMA Best Pairs Speedway National Champion in 2018 and 2019.[1] In 2021, he joined the Plymouth Gladiators for his first season in British speedway, riding in the SGB Championship 2021.[3][2] In 2022, Ruml signed for the Oxford Cheetahs for the 2022 season. The Cheetahs were returning to action after a 14-year absence from British Speedway.[4][5] He was named rider of the year for the Cheetahs but was released at the end of the season due to difficulties over the points limit for 2023.[6]

Family edit

He is the younger brother of fellow Speedway rider Max Ruml.[1]
